Investors tracking leather penny stocks in India 2027 are looking at a mix of legacy names and smaller leather players still trading under Rs 100 a share. Mirza International Ltd. and KSR Footwear Ltd. anchor this list by market cap, while smaller names such as AKI India Ltd. remain firmly in penny-stock territory.

India is among the world's largest leather and footwear producers and exporters, but the listed leather and footwear space is small and has been squeezed by weak export demand, raw hide cost swings and competition from synthetic alternatives, keeping several once-larger names at low absolute prices.

This article lists 5 leather stocks worth tracking for 2027, along with their current price, market capitalisation, valuation ratios and the key risks each one carries.

1. Mirza International Ltd.

CMP: Rs 29.4 | Market Cap: Rs 409.00 Cr

Mirza International Ltd. is the maker of the Red Tape footwear brand, currently loss-making but with very low debt. The stock trades at no meaningful PE (loss-making), with an ROE of -3.20% and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.03.

2. KSR Footwear Ltd.

CMP: Rs 44.4 | Market Cap: Rs 81.00 Cr

KSR Footwear Ltd. is a footwear manufacturer currently posting losses. The stock trades at no meaningful PE (loss-making), with an ROE of -16.87% and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.45.

3. Mayur Leather Products Ltd.

CMP: Rs 36.59 | Market Cap: Rs 18.00 Cr

Mayur Leather Products Ltd. is a small leather footwear and products maker with solid ROE. The stock trades at a PE of 15.84, with an ROE of 14.16% and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.26.

4. Super Tannery Ltd.

CMP: Rs 9.67 | Market Cap: Rs 107.00 Cr

Super Tannery Ltd. is a finished leather exporter trading below the sector PE. The stock trades at a PE of 15.50, with an ROE of 6.12% and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.84.

5. AKI India Ltd.

CMP: Rs 5.84 | Market Cap: Rs 61.00 Cr

AKI India Ltd. is a small leather chemicals and finishing company. The stock trades at a PE of 20.28, with an ROE of 1.93% and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.21.

What Are Leather Penny Stocks?

Leather penny stocks are shares of companies operating in the leather sector that trade at a low absolute price, usually under Rs 100, and often carry a small or micro market capitalisation. They give retail investors an inexpensive way to participate in the sector, but the low price also means wide daily swings, thin liquidity in some cases and, for several names on this list, negative or inconsistent earnings. These should be treated as a small, high-risk slice of a diversified portfolio rather than a core holding.

India's Leather Sector: 2027 Overview

India is among the world's largest leather and footwear producers and exporters, but the listed leather and footwear space is small and has been squeezed by weak export demand, raw hide cost swings and competition from synthetic alternatives, keeping several once-larger names at low absolute prices.

Factors to Consider Before Investing

  • Debt levels: Several names on this list carry negative book values or high leverage, so check the debt-to-equity ratio before investing.
  • Earnings consistency: Some of these companies are currently loss-making; track the trend in losses rather than the absolute number alone.
  • Liquidity: Several small-cap and micro-cap names here trade with thin daily volumes, which can widen bid-ask spreads.
  • Valuation versus earnings: Compare each stock's PE ratio against the sector PE to avoid overpaying for a re-rated stock.
  • Sector cycle: Leather companies are sensitive to sector-specific cycles, so track the relevant demand and pricing trends closely.

Risks to Watch

  • High volatility: Several stocks on this list can move sharply on thin volumes.
  • Negative book values: More than one name here carries a negative book value, reflecting accumulated losses.
  • Thin liquidity: Micro-cap names on this list see low daily trading volumes.
  • Inconsistent earnings: Several companies here are currently loss-making or have very high PE ratios on thin earnings.
